Output dd436930e52e3e202f0cc2db6156e7f93c05ee352daeb885fbc75979d592d50d:0

value
1974617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83d9f88e8b23023448daa0b18a7e2f187617a9cb OP_EQUAL
address
3DiBZZNTL4ZDPjtTZFT6FQ4kwtAmLAGA1k
transaction
dd436930e52e3e202f0cc2db6156e7f93c05ee352daeb885fbc75979d592d50d
spent
true